This is an exciting opportunity for a suitably qualified clinician to join our expanding Acute Medicine service at Wirral University Teaching Hospital NHS Foundation Trust.
The postholder will provide senior clinical leadership across the 27 inpatient beds on the Acute Medical Unit (AMU) and Urgent Medical Assessment Centre (UMAC), as well as supporting post-take review of medical patients within the Emergency Department.
You will be part of a committed team of Acute Medicine Consultants and the wider multidisciplinary team based at Arrowe Park Hospital. The Acute Medicine footprint is currently under review as part of a major reconfiguration, making this a particularly exciting time to join and contribute to the development of a redeveloping and evolving service. The role also offers the opportunity to support the department’s research agenda and to play a key part in shaping the future of our Same Day Emergency Care (SDEC) model, including integration with system partners.
Applicants must be fully registered on the UK General Medical Council’s Specialist Register, or within six months of achieving CCT/CESR at the time of interview.
